Emergency Planning Exercise for La Collette

28 November 2008

Businesses in and around La Collette will learn how to deal with a terrorist attack during a simulated exercise to be hosted by the States of Jersey Emergency Planning Officer and the States of Jersey Police Counter Terrorism Security Officer on Tuesday 2 December.

Using Project Argus, a framework developed by the UK National Counter Terrorism Security Office (NaCTSO), they will explore ways in which organisations can prevent, handle and recover from a major incident. This will involve taking participants from businesses located at La Collette through a simulated exercise.

The event explores what is likely to happen in the event of a terrorist attack, options to consider and how to decide what the priorities should be. Project Argus highlights the importance of being prepared and having the necessary plans in place to help safeguard an organisation’s staff, customers and company assets.

The skills learnt at this event are also transferable to other emergency situations, such as a fire or gas leak.
